Why last year’s pay survey already misleads UK drone professionals Ask a BVLOS Pilot stitching flight plans over the Irish Sea, a Drone Data Analyst crunching multispectral crop imagery, or an Avionics Engineer debugging quad‑rotor ESCs at midnight: “Am I earning what I deserve?” The honest answer drifts faster than a geofence breach. Since early 2024 the Civil Aviation Authority (CAA) introduced sandbox corridors for beyond‑visual‑line‑of‑sight operations, Network Rail signed a multi‑million‑pound inspection contract, & the UK’s Future Flight Challenge pumped an extra £105 million into autonomous‑air‑mobility trials. Each shock nudges salary bands. A salary guide printed in 2024 is already a fossil — blind to the surge in middle‑mile drone logistics, the Highlands’ offshore wind survey boom, or the police drones standard now mandating dual‑thermal payloads. To replace guesswork with evidence, UAVJobs.co.uk has distilled a transparent three‑factor formula. Plug in your discipline, UK region & seniority; you’ll see a realistic 2025 baseline — no stale averages, no fuzzy “competitive” labels. This article unpacks the formula, spotlights six forces inflating UAV pay, & sets out five practical moves to boost your market value inside ninety days.
